Training is an important part of developing human resources and improving the performance of workers in all fields, including the health sector, as training directly affects the enhancement of the individual's technical skills and knowledge, and the development of his behavioral and professional capabilities. According to statistics, and in light of the continuous development of the health sector and the increasing challenges it faces, continuous training is considered an essential tool for developing the behavioral competencies of workers in this sector. Behavioral competencies include a set of skills and attitudes that help workers deal effectively with patients and society. Therefore, this study aimed to determine the role of continuous training in developing the behavioral competencies of workers at King Fahd Hospital, and to determine how to apply this role effectively at King Fahd Hospital. This study also aimed to clarify the role of continuous training in developing the behavioral competencies of workers at King Fahd Hospital. The study also aimed to determine the level of development of behavioral competencies of workers at King Fahd Hospital, and to determine the extent of application of continuous training at King Fahd Hospital. The descriptive analytical approach was relied upon; Which is based on combining the office study and the field study to analyze and treat the problem. The research community includes a sample of workers in King Fahd Hospital in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ia. The sample to be applied to will be chosen randomly, according to the size of the research community, which amounts to (1000) workers from the medical and nursing staff in King Fahd Hospital in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ia. The sample size was determined in light of using the sample size determination equation, and the sample size was estimated at 350. The study tested all its hypotheses.
